### Runbook: BounceBroom — Account Recovery

If the BounceBroom email bounce processor loses access to its service account, do not create a new one. First, pause the intake queue so bounces buffer safely. Then open the recovery console and select the BounceBroom principal. Verification requires approval from the on-call lead. Once approved, the console prompts for the stored recovery credentials; enter the passphrase that appears directly below this paragraph.

recovery phrase for fahof-kahap: holion-gormir-jorix-istix-briwyn-sorael

Subject: Diffscope cut-over complete

Hello plugin authors,

The cut-over of Diffscope's large-file diff viewer to the new chunked renderer finished last night. Files over the size threshold now stream in segments, so plugins that assumed a fully materialized buffer must switch to the segment API. Legacy endpoints remain available for thirty days, then return a deprecation error. Rate limits are unchanged. To help you test against the new behavior, the production service now runs with the following configuration values.

service settings:
[pelys]
team = druys
access_code = ac_54772a
host = pelys.halixnet.corp
port = 9200
owner = noveth.kelax
peer = ralius.ferradata.corp

Department heads should note that Varnholt Systems projects a moderate cash surplus through Q3, driven by earlier-than-expected collections on the Dunmere contract and deferred capital spending in the Atherleigh facility. Receivables aging has improved by six days since last quarter. Payroll and vendor obligations remain fully covered under the base scenario, though the downside case assumes a two-week slip in Dunmere payments. The following note outlines the confidential planning implications.

management briefing: Project Ulavan slips by two quarters because of the staffing delay.